World Rugby and Emirates have announced a decade-long extension of their partnership, solidifying the airline’s position as the principal partner of every Rugby World Cup through 2035. The agreement encompasses both the men’s and women’s Rugby World Cups, as well as all global qualifying events. World Rugby’s official announcement details the expanded scope of the collaboration.
Partnership Details
Under the renewed agreement, Emirates elevates its status to a World Rugby platinum partner. the airline’s “Fly Better” branding will remain prominently displayed on the uniforms of all match officials during Rugby World Cups and international fixtures. This visual presence extends to all global qualifying events, maximizing brand exposure.
The partnership isn’t solely about branding. It also focuses on supporting the advancement of the game at all levels. World Rugby Chairman Sir Bill Beaumont emphasized the importance of the collaboration, stating, ”Emirates’ commitment to rugby is unwavering, and this long-term partnership is a testament to the shared values and vision we have for the future of the game.” He further noted the airline’s support for match officials, which has been instrumental in advancing the game, and expressed confidence in continuing to inspire new fans and expand rugby’s global reach.
emirates will also continue to receive prominent pitch-side advertising and digital branding opportunities at all major tournaments.

Impact on Rugby World Cups
The extension ensures continuity in branding and sponsorship for upcoming rugby World Cups. The 2027 Men’s Rugby World Cup in australia and the 2029 Women’s Rugby World Cup in England will both benefit from Emirates’ support. The partnership will also play a vital role in supporting the qualification processes for these tournaments, ensuring a wider range of nations have the opportunity to compete on the world stage.
